Why these movies?
The story pattern: The narrative often centers on a young protagonist navigating a world of adult secrets, generational clashes, and shifting family foundations. The plot unfolds not through high drama but through accumulated small observations, leading to a personal awakening that is both poignant and understated.
Why they belong together: These films are grouped by their shared perspective and mood. They prioritize emotional authenticity over plot twists, offering a gentle, sometimes uneasy, blend of sentimentality and the sharp clarity of a child's witnessing gaze.
